Access to most recent issues (within the last 24 months) requires a yearly paid subscription. This site provides digital access (Adobe PDF Reader required) to these recent issues of the Journal alongside issues dating back to Volume 121, No. 1 (March 2012). 

Access to all other issues of the Journal is open and free-of-charge. The University of Auckland Library site holds all issues of the Journal (except for the last two complete years) dating back to 1892 along with some Memoirs. This site is open access and does not require a login.
